    incumbency
    /ɪnˈkʌmbənsi/

    noun

    • 1. the holding of an office or the period during which one is held: "during his incumbency he established an epidemic warning system"

  5. the quality or state of being incumbent. the position or term of an incumbent. something that is incumbent. a duty or obligation: my incumbencies as head of the organization. Archaic. an incumbent weight or mass. incumbency. / ɪnˈkʌmbənsɪ /.
